Hi Pawel,

On 12/10/2020 09:42, Pawel Laszczak wrote:
> On failure, the platform_get_irq_byname prints an error message
> so, patch removes error message related to this function from
> core.c file.
> 
> A change was suggested during reviewing CDNSP driver by Chunfeng Yun.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Pawel Laszczak <pawell@cadence.com>
> ---
> Changelog:
> v2
> - simplified code as sugested by Roger Quadros.
> 
>   drivers/usb/cdns3/core.c | 10 +---------
>   1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 9 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/usb/cdns3/core.c b/drivers/usb/cdns3/core.c
> index a0f73d4711ae..85ef3025b293 100644
> --- a/drivers/usb/cdns3/core.c
> +++ b/drivers/usb/cdns3/core.c
> @@ -469,22 +469,14 @@ static int cdns3_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
>   	if (cdns->dev_irq == -EPROBE_DEFER)

Shouldn't this be
	if (cdns->dev_irq < 0)
?

>   		return cdns->dev_irq;
>   
> -	if (cdns->dev_irq < 0)
> -		dev_err(dev, "couldn't get peripheral irq\n");
> -
>   	regs = devm_platform_ioremap_resource_byname(pdev, "dev");
>   	if (IS_ERR(regs))
>   		return PTR_ERR(regs);
>   	cdns->dev_regs	= regs;
>   
>   	cdns->otg_irq = platform_get_irq_byname(pdev, "otg");
> -	if (cdns->otg_irq == -EPROBE_DEFER)
> -		return cdns->otg_irq;
> -
> -	if (cdns->otg_irq < 0) {
> -		dev_err(dev, "couldn't get otg irq\n");
> +	if (cdns->otg_irq < 0)
>   		return cdns->otg_irq;
> -	}
>   
>   	res = platform_get_resource_byname(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, "otg");
>   	if (!res) {
>
